Abstract
A hydraulically actuated running and setting tool includes a stationary setting tool mandrel that is connected to the packer by releaseable collets. Variable volume chambers are provided in the tool that are arranged so that no downward movement of the components relative to the space in the well bore below the packer is necessary. Setting is accomplished by hydraulic pressure and testing of the packer can occur prior to release of the setting tool from the packer. Release of the setting tool from the packer occurs by pulling upwardly on the setting tool with equalization of the pressure above and below the packer or applying additional hydraulic pressure as in setting until sufficient force is developed to part a shear member.
